Instituto AgronĂ´mico de Campinas
The Instituto AgronĂ´mico de Campinas (Agronomical Institute of Campinas -- IAC) is a research and development institution affiliated to the AgĂŞncia Paulista de Tecnologia dos AgronegĂłcios (SĂŁo Paulo Agency of Agrobusiness Technology), of the Secretary of Agriculture of the state of SĂŁo Paulo, Brazil, with headquarters in the city of Campinas. It is the oldest institution of its kind in Latin America, having been founded by Emperor Dom Pedro II in 1887 as the Imperial Agronomical Station of Campinas.
